Switch from FloatMath -> Math and Math.hypot where possible The motivation is an API change: FloatMath is going to be deprecated and/or removed. Performance is not the goal of this change. That said... Math is faster than FloatMath with AOT compilation. While making the change, occurances of: {Float}Math.sqrt(x * x + y * y) and {Float}Math.sqrt({Float}Math.pow(x, 2) + {Float}Math.pow(y, 2)) have been replaced with: {(float)} Math.hypot(x, y) Right now there is no runtime intrinsic for hypot so is not faster in all cases for AOT compilation: Math.sqrt(x * x + y * y) is faster than Math.hypot(x, y) with AOT, but all other combinations of FloatMath, use of pow() etc. are slower than hypot(). hypot() has the advantage of being self documenting and could be optimized in future. None of the behavior differences around NaN and rounding appear to be important for the cases looked at: they all assume results and arguments are in range and usually the results are cast to float. Different implementations measured on hammerhead / L: AOT compiled: [FloatMath.hypot(x, y)] benchmark=Hypot_FloatMathHypot} 633.85 ns; σ=0.32 ns @ 3 trials [FloatMath.sqrt(x*x + y*y)] benchmark=Hypot_FloatMathSqrtMult} 684.17 ns; σ=4.83 ns @ 3 trials [FloatMath.sqrt(FloatMath.pow(x, 2) + FloatMath.pow(y, 2))] benchmark=Hypot_FloatMathSqrtPow} 1270.65 ns; σ=12.20 ns @ 6 trials [(float) Math.hypot(x, y)] benchmark=Hypot_MathHypot} 96.80 ns; σ=0.05 ns @ 3 trials [(float) Math.sqrt(x*x + y*y)] benchmark=Hypot_MathSqrtMult} 23.97 ns; σ=0.01 ns @ 3 trials [(float) Math.sqrt(Math.pow(x, 2) + Math.pow(y, 2))] benchmark=Hypot_MathSqrtPow} 156.19 ns; σ=0.12 ns @ 3 trials Interpreter: benchmark=Hypot_FloatMathHypot} 1180.54 ns; σ=5.13 ns @ 3 trials benchmark=Hypot_FloatMathSqrtMult} 1121.05 ns; σ=3.80 ns @ 3 trials benchmark=Hypot_FloatMathSqrtPow} 3327.14 ns; σ=7.33 ns @ 3 trials benchmark=Hypot_MathHypot} 856.57 ns; σ=1.41 ns @ 3 trials benchmark=Hypot_MathSqrtMult} 1028.92 ns; σ=9.11 ns @ 3 trials benchmark=Hypot_MathSqrtPow} 2539.47 ns; σ=24.44 ns @ 3 trials Bug: https://code.google.com/p/android/issues/detail?id=36199 Change-Id: I06c91f682095e627cb547d60d936ef87941be692

Refactor of camera stress test to add camera test helper. Also add additional functional tests for: flash, exposure, white balance, and focus mode. Also add pairwise tests. Slight refactor to add camera test helper and also additional tests for: flash, exposure, white balance, and focus mode Bug: 9174937 Change-Id: I3d26b545dc8ff972c8173066df59a2e572a837ef
